Abstract:
An expansible, compressed foam is used as a filter medium and captured particulates are released from the foam by expanding the foam to open its pores. Micro-organisms such as Cryptosporidium or Giardia cysts may be trapped and recovered at high eficiency in a small volume of wash liquid easing further analysis. A foam filter element comprises thirty discs (36) of retriculated foam compressed between end plates (28, 30) to about one tenth of their original thickness.

Abstract:
A filtration system interconnection structure having a filter manifold including a sump housing and a first correlated magnet located on or connected to a portion of the manifold, and a filter cartridge including a filter media, first and second end caps sealed to the filter media, and a second, paired correlated magnet located on or connected to the filter cartridge housing body. The first and second correlated magnets are interconnected via magnetic communication upon insertion of the filter cartridge into the sump housing, and upon movement of the filter cartridge into an alignment position, the correlated magnet located on or connected to the manifold is permitted to translate as a result of the magnetic communication. The polarity profiles of the paired correlated magnets are aligned such that a repulsion force is created when the filter cartridge is inserted within the manifold sump housing.
